Pre-open movers
US stock futures traded higher in early pre-market trade. Data on Nonfarm payrolls and international trade for November will be released at 8:30 a.m. ET. Futures for the Dow Jones Industrial Average jumped 54.5 points to 17,540.5, while the Standard & Poor's 500 index futures rose 6.75 point to 2,058.00. Futures for the Nasdaq 100 index gained 11.50 points to 4,622.50.
A Peek Into Global Markets
European markets were lower today, with the Spanish Ibex Index declining 0.66 percent, STOXX Europe 600 Index falling 0.43 percent and German DAX 30 index dropping 0.40 percent. French CAC 40 Index dipped 0.46 percent and London's FTSE 100 Index fell 0.14 percent. In Asian markets, Japan's Nikkei Stock Average fell 2.18 percent, Hong Kong's Hang Seng Index fell 0.81 percent, China's Shanghai Composite Index slipped 1.67 percent and India's BSE Sensex dropped 0.96 percent.
